Hey, I am a first year student at Wharton and I would have to say that life at Wharton is what you make it. I have never pulled an all nighter here and my GPA is great. The problem here is that a lot of people join way too many clubs and rush for frats/ sori. all at the same time because they think it looks good. Unfortunately, they pay the price of sleeping in John M. Huntsman Hall. So as the last comment says, you simply have to be a master at managing your time. Also, there is a lot of competition at Wharton, but I'd say at this point it's "healthy." In other words, it's competition that brings out the best in both of us.
